> DISA FSO has provided the following patches based on end-user feedback and updates done amongst the DISA FSO staff. Submitting to list on their behalf.
>
> -shawn
>
> Leland Steinke (21):
>    Update aide_build_database
>    Add VMS/DPMS mappings in stig_overlay
>    Update VRelease attributes for DISA FSO VMS tags
>    Add set_ip6tables_default_rule to common, map to STIG RHEL-06-000523
>    Update VRelease attribute for RHEL-06-000008
>      (ensure_redhat_gpgkey_installed)
>    Add reload to set_ip6tables_default_rule
>    [bugfix] modify file_permissions_library_dirs to follow symlinks
>    [bugfix] Modify file_permissions_binary_dirs to follow symlinks
>    Increment VRelease for
>      sysctl_ipv6_default_accept_redirects/RHEL-06-000099
>    Check syscall audits explicitly to avoid partial matches
>    Add applicability statement to audit_rules_time_stime/RHEL-06-000169
>    Give SELinux precedence over HBSS in install_hids/RHEL-06-000285
>    Update install_antivirus/RHEL-06-000284 from uvscan to VSEL/nails
>    Remove display_login_attempts/RHEL-06-000506 from RHEL 6 STIG
>    Add display_login_attempts/RHEL-06-000372 to STIG
>    [bugfix] Update selinux_all_devicefiles to "any_exist"
>    Increment OVAL version for selinux_all_devicefiles_labeled
>    Update OVAL version for sysctl_net_ipv6_conf_default_accept_redirects
>    Fix lowercase in system/auditing.xml
>    Update severity of aide_build_database in stig_overlay.xml
>    [bugfix] Correct static sysctl.conf check regex and increment
>      versions
